How Much Does It Cost to Clad a House in the UK?
UK house cladding costs depend primarily on material choice, with timber cladding starting from £40 per square metre including installation, whilst premium options like natural stone can exceed £120 per square metre. A typical three-bedroom semi-detached house requires approximately 150-200 square metres of cladding coverage, translating to total project costs between £12,000 and £25,000 for most homeowners.
Regional variations significantly impact pricing, with London and South East England commanding premium rates due to higher labour costs and stricter planning requirements. Northern regions often offer more competitive pricing, though material transportation costs can offset some savings for specialised cladding systems.
| Cladding Material | Cost per m² (inc. installation) | Typical House Cost | Lifespan |
|---|---|---|---|
| UPVC Cladding | £35-50 | £8,000-12,000 | 25-30 years |
| Timber Cladding | £40-80 | £10,000-18,000 | 20-40 years |
| Fibre Cement | £60-90 | £15,000-22,000 | 50+ years |
| Metal Cladding | £70-110 | £18,000-28,000 | 40-60 years |
| Natural Stone | £90-150 | £25,000-40,000 | 100+ years |

Is It Cheaper to Clad or Render a House?
Rendering typically proves less expensive than cladding for initial installation, with basic render systems costing £25-45 per square metre compared to cladding’s £40-120 range. However, this cost comparison becomes more complex when considering long-term maintenance requirements and thermal performance benefits that cladding systems often provide.
Modern render systems require regular maintenance every 10-15 years, including cleaning, minor repairs, and potential recoating, whilst quality cladding materials often maintain their appearance and performance for decades with minimal intervention. The superior insulation properties of many cladding systems can also deliver ongoing energy savings that offset the higher initial investment over time.
Is House Cladding Worth It?
House cladding delivers substantial value through improved thermal efficiency, weather protection, and aesthetic enhancement that can increase property values by 5-10% when professionally installed. The investment typically pays for itself through reduced heating costs, with modern cladding systems improving home energy ratings and qualifying properties for better EPC certificates.
Beyond financial considerations, cladding provides long-term protection against weather damage, reduces maintenance requirements, and allows homeowners to completely transform their property’s appearance without structural alterations. Quality cladding systems also address common issues like dampness and thermal bridging that affect many UK properties, particularly those built before modern building standards were implemented.

Can I Clad My House Without Planning Permission?
Most house cladding projects fall under permitted development rights, allowing homeowners to proceed without formal planning permission provided the work meets specific criteria outlined in the General Permitted Development Order. However, properties in conservation areas, listed buildings, or areas with Article 4 directions require planning permission regardless of the proposed cladding materials or design.
Key restrictions include maintaining the original building’s character, ensuring cladding doesn’t extend beyond the original roofline, and using appropriate materials that comply with local planning policies. The Planning Portal provides comprehensive guidance on permitted development rights, whilst the Building Regulations must still be satisfied for thermal performance and fire safety compliance regardless of planning permission requirements.
